Q: Why did the Bramblewick image shrink from 1.2 GB to 180 MB, and do I need to do anything?

A: We moved to a distroless base and stripped the debug toolchain — so no shell in prod containers anymore, heads up. Builds are faster, pulls are cheaper. One catch: the slim image can't decrypt the seed config on its own at first boot. For that, the init step prompts for the recovery passphrase given below.

unlock words, yawig-kagef: gordor-holvan-ulaael-pramir-ulaiel-tamdor

## Environments — Pricefern Catalog Cache

Pricefern runs three environments: dev, staging, and prod. Cache invalidation in the catalog tier is event-driven; staging mirrors prod TTLs so contractors can validate purge behavior safely. Always test invalidation hooks in staging first, as prod purges fan out to regional replicas. The staging environment uses the configuration values shown below.

service settings:
PRAWYN_PIN=9848
PRAWYN_METRICS_HOST=metrics.prawyn.lumicworks.corp
PRAWYN_LOG_LEVEL=warn
PRAWYN_TENANT=pelius

Off-site run checklist, item 7: Collect the sealed envelope of original score sheets from the Tarnwell Regional Chess Final at the front desk of the Bellmere Club annex. Verify the seal is intact and the arbiter's signature is visible before loading. Keep the envelope flat and dry in transit. The courier hand-over instruction is appended below.

courier memo of yawep-yafog: the pramir ulaix courier leaves the ulavan aldix frair zorok oliiel joreth rusdor fenvan ledger at gate 1305 under passcode 514738

Action item from the Inkwell bounce-processor incident: our retry ladder was way too aggressive, so soft bounces hammered the upstream relay during its outage and we got rate-limited into oblivion. Fix is to widen the backoff and cap concurrent retries per domain. Dagny owns the change; target is next Thursday. For the sync, the proposed new constants are listed here.

tuning table, hafog-bahaf:
QUOTAS = {
    "praion": 144,
    "briax": 906,
    "silwyn": 451,
}